About Scottish Rite Park in Des Moines, Iowa

Welcome to Scottish Rite Park! 10-acres of serene woods surround a beautiful and modern building located on manicured grounds. This peaceful setting, located in the heart of Des Moines, is just west of downtown. There is ample room for parking including attached and detached garages. A large garden area allows residents the opportunity to grow their own flowers and vegetables.Scottish Rite Park ensures you the freedom of an active lifestyle in gracious surroundings. The quality, the beauty and the convenient location combine to offer a most attractive retirement setting. The nonprofit corporation, Scottish Rite Park, Incorporated, owns and operates this modern, thirteen-story, 156 unit building. Although built in 1973, it competes and exceeds today's newer facilities. Most importantly… Scottish Rite Park is a full service retirement community offering all levels of retirement living. My husband and I live at Scottish Rite Park. We have been here for 10 years, so this is home for us. We are in an independent living situation, but adjacent to us in the building, we have health care, memory care, and assisted living. So it's a full continuum of care. The community is well organized. They're sensitive to elderly needs. Good communication, good food. It's an excellent community. We've been very, very thankful to be here. It was where we would have wanted my brother to be initially, but they have only a limited assisted living unit. But it has priority to those who come from their independent living units, so there's quite a waiting list for assisted living, so my brother was not able to come here. The food is excellent. They have a good chef. There's variety and adaptation to people's needs. The building was built in the 1970s, but they are constantly updating. Right now, they're updating our water system so that we have a more balanced water system in regard to the heat and cold and so forth of the water. They're constantly working. It was built by the Masonic Group of Des Moines. You don't have to be a masonic member to live here, but it was established in the 1970s by the Masons and they've done a good job of keeping the facility in beautiful condition.

My parents-in-law are in Scottish Rite Park. They've been there a little over a year. They have both independent living and assisted living. If one requires one care and the other one requires another care, they can't live together. That was our problem with my in-laws. They've enjoyed it thus far. According to my mother-in-law, there's a sense of community there. They enjoy the activities and the staff. We've only been able to visit just recently because of the lockdown. Most of these buildings were locked down, so I personally haven't been around a lot. It's a very nice facility. The apartments are nice, and they will decorate and redo them as the residents desire. They had a standard 2-bedroom, which was a very nice apartment for them. They're not together in one room, but they used to be. Once the residents needed assistance, they had to go to another room in the same facility. If the residents required two different levels of care, they can't live together. I know there is a pool that they like to go to. They have a library, game nights, a movie theater, a newspaper that they put out throughout the community, woodworking classes, and different art classes. That's what I know that they participated in, but I'm sure there's more.
